I think someone concerned with paying "<$750/CPU" would be unlikely to want to fill 16 channels of RAM... that's a lot of money, relatively speaking.

But, maybe their home server's singular purpose is to have a lot of RAM?



The memory (64GB ea) for each socket in my old server cost about as much as the CPU for the respective socket, about 550€ each. (i.e. 1100€ per socket.)

For a 7282 box I'd spend about as much on the RAM as on the CPU again; 16GB DDR4-3200R sticks are about 80€ each, so filling one socket is 640€. The 7282 currently sells for ~700€ currently so that lines up all right.

(This would give me 2×128GB total; 32GB RAM sticks are unfortunately indeed still a bit too expensive, especially at 3200MHz rating. But maybe I should go with 32GB and half fill each socket & fill it out later when it's cheaper...)
